Title of article :
Synthesis and reactions of the ferrocene derived hydroxymethyl phosphine FcCH(CH3)P(CH2OH)2 and its sulfide: crystal structures of [FcCH(CH3)P(S)R2] R=CH2OH, CH2CH2CN and FcCH(CH3)P(S)(CH2O)2PPh (Fc=ferrocenyl)

Abstract :
The racemic ferrocene derived hydroxymethyl phosphine FcCH(CH3)P(CH2OH)2 (1) (Fc=ferrocenyl) was prepared by the reaction of P(CH2OH)3 with [FcCH(CH3) NEt2Me]+I−. The latter was prepared by the reduction of acetyl ferrocene to the corresponding alcohol, which was converted into its acetate and reacted further with diethylamine, followed by methyl iodide. Reaction of 1 with acrylonitrile yielded the phosphine FcCH(CH3)P(CH2CH2CN)2 (2), while reaction of 1 with morpholine yielded FcCH(CH3)P[CH2(NC4H8O)]2 (3). Reactions of compounds 1–3 with elemental sulfur yielded the corresponding phosphine sulfides 4–6. The hydroxymethyl groups of the phosphine sulfide FcCHCH3P(S)(CH2OH)2 (4) reacted readily with PhPCl2 and O(SiMe2Cl)2 forming six- and eight-membered heterocycles FcCH(CH3)P(S)(CH2O)2PPh (7) and FcCH(CH3)P(S)(CH2OSiMe2)2O (8), respectively. The crystal structures of compounds 4, 5 and 7 were determined.
